It is possible to move a treadmill that folds flat but you should do it with caution. If you're moving it to another room or to a new home be sure to check the manufacturer's guidelines before attempting to move the treadmill. These are available on the internet or in the user's manual. These directions will aid you in determining if your treadmill is too heavy to be lifted on its own and if it will fit through the doorways of the new place.
If you are moving on a treadmill, either up or down the stairs and you want to place the more powerful person downstairs first. They will be able to carry the most weight and should be supported by a spotter for support if necessary. Then move the treadmill up and down using areas that are solid and avoid using plastic parts or the control panel for grips. To avoid slippage and injury, wear gloves or wipe your hands if they are sweaty.
Some treadmills have a handle on the side to carry them, while others come with a fold-on-base design which allows you to move it without taking off the deck or removing it from the base. Always read the manufacturer's guidelines and follow them when transporting the treadmill.

Another important factor to consider when deciding on a treadmill folding is whether it has safety features. Look for an emergency stop button that will shut down the machine if you trip or fall. You should also be able maneuver the machine using the handle. Avoid stepping on it when it's moving.
